Instructions
- 01
Pour the rice in a rice cooker, followed by a cup of water and a cup of chicken stock. Set it and forget it.
- 02
In a medium mixing bowl, add the garlic powder, Italian seasoning, onion powder, paprika, salt and a crack of black pepper. Whisk to combine and add the chicken. Add a couple tablespoons olive oil and stir to fully coat.
- 03
In a wide skillet, add a little oil and bring to a medium-high heat. Add the diced onion. Season with a pinch of salt and let it sauté for a couple of minutes. Make room in the center and add the seasoned chicken to the pan in a single layer. Let this sear for two minutes. Flip around and sear another two minutes. Add the garlic to the pan, along with a splash of stock to loosen any browned bits. Sauté for 30 seconds, letting the garlic bloom. It will all so fragrant right now. You will cry.
- 04
Add the rest of the stock and the milk to the pan. Simmer on medium for a few minutes, letting it all thicken up a little. If you need to add a little slurry mix (cornstarch and water), do so!
- 05
Serve the creamy chicken over rice and garnish with chopped parsley. Perfect!
- 06
Serves 4.
